Job DetailsJob LocationCatholic Charities Smith - Denver, COPosition TypeFull TimeEducation Level4 Year DegreeSalary Range$56,485.00 - $58,000.00 SalaryDescriptionApplications accepted on an ongoing basis until position is filled.Grant WriterOUR PURPOSECatholic Charities of the Archdiocese of Denver has been serving Northern Colorado since 1927. We serve tens of thousands of people each year in seven ministries : Marisol Services, Early Childhood Education, Shelter Services, Catholic Charities Housing, St. Raphael Counseling, Family, Kinship, and Senior Services; and Parish & Community Engagement.Our employees are crucial to our success in achieving our mission to extend the healing ministry of Jesus Christ to the poor and those in need. Catholic Charities provides a work environment where self-motivated and mission driven individuals are recognized and rewarded. Catholic Charities is an Equal Opportunity Employer. We are committed to welcoming applicants and program participants of all faiths; as well as an inclusive and welcoming environment for staff, volunteers, and program participants. Candidates who bring diversity to our team are encouraged to apply.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IESPerform the full range of activities required to prepare and submit grant applications / proposals to private and public fundersResearch pertinent databases and other online sources to evaluate and discern potential new sources of grant fundingWork with program managers and accounting to gather the information necessary to report on grants from private and public fundersCoordinate the internal review of grant agreements / contracts to ensure that Catholic Charities can meet / comply with agreement / contract expectations, insurance requirements and terminologyMeet periodically with program managers either in person, through e-mail or by phone to keep up to date on program changes and discuss each program's funding needsMeet periodically with representatives from private funders to present Catholic Charities' programs that meet their funding prioritiesAttend in-person or online informational meetings (webinars) put on by grant funders pertaining to specific grant opportunitiesMaintain the grants database and adhere to the grants schedule to ensure that all application / proposal deadlines are metQualificationsStrong writing and editing skills and the ability to write clear, structured, articulate and persuasive proposalsStrong verbal communication skills and the ability to interact daily with many different audiencesAttention to detailAbility to meet deadlines; experience working in a deadline-driven environmentFamiliarity and knowledge of grant sourcesExperience with proposal writing and institutional donorsPrevious experience with non-profit fundraisingAble to work well in a team environment and handle multiple assignmentsEDUCATION and / or EXPERIENCE Bachelor's degree and minimum of three years of experience in grant writing, fundraising and research; non-profit experience preferred COMPENSATION & BENEFITS$56,485-$58,000Schedule : This is a full-time position, 40 hours per week. This position is hybrid, requiring in-office work on Mondays and Wednesdays.Training : We provide a robust training curriculum that will support our employees throughout their career. Training provided within the first year of employment includes : De-escalation & Safety; Public Speaking; Mental Health First Aid; Substance Abuse & Mental Health; Human Trafficking; Trauma Informed Care; and many more.Benefits : In addition to being part of a higher purpose while working in a challenging yet rewarding environment, eligible Catholic Charities employees receive a generous benefits package, including : Extensive Paid Time Off including 15 Paid Holidays annually (4 weeks accrual for new employees - increasing yearly) promoting work life balance.403b Retirement Plan with Agency contribution of 4% & match up to 2% of annual compensation.Choice of 3 PPO Medical Plans (90% of employee's and 75% of dependent's premiums is paid by Agency), Dental, & Vision starting the 1st day of the month following start date.May be eligible for Public Service Loan Forgiveness through Federal Student Loans and many more benefits.ARE YOU READY TO JOIN OUR TEAM?
